Find the equation of a line through (2,-4) and (-7,-4)
steposvetlana [31]
---------------------------------------------
Find slope : 
---------------------------------------------
\text {Slope = }  \dfrac{-4 - (-4)}{-7-2}  =  \dfrac{0}{-9}  = 0

When the slope is 0, the graph is a horizontal line.

Equation of the graph is y = -4

------------------------------------------------------
Answer: y = -4
